Output 5cd85be10f490f2ff3ea493ee995d89a17128e03d3ea5663408f97da38d80aaf:0

value
69482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cbd164e39687aa64e7039abacc286faefb21c6 OP_EQUAL
address
34xHjn1vbZjBFUi1aLAdjsF9dByKQhgBCJ
transaction
5cd85be10f490f2ff3ea493ee995d89a17128e03d3ea5663408f97da38d80aaf
confirmations
171141
spent
true